HFA Goals and Activities

HFA works to promote Freedom and Democracy by inspiring people to use reason and science to create a more compassionate society.  Our focal issues are: Democracy, Science, Education and Community.

HFA has accomplished a tremendous amount in the past few years including:
 

        Democracy:

  • Held a First Amendment Rally in Brevard County.
  • Held a Democracy not Theocracy Rally in Manatee County.
  • Helped organized state and regional progressive summits.
  • Founded the Florida Progressive Information Network.
  • Been interviewed by reporters for the Miami Herald, the Jacksonville Times Union, the Tampa Tribune and America AM talk radio on theocracy related issues.

Goal: Humanists are dedicated to Democracy as an ethical form of government that allows for individual freedom while promoting personal responsibility.  Our goal is to create a more compassionate society through the use of reason and science.

Our work on behalf of Democracy focuses on 2 main areas.

  • Promoting Democracy over theocracy through defense of the First Amendment 
  • Promoting Ethical Government.

Science

  • Organized a state coalition to promote improved science standards in Florida
  • Created a journal on the state of science education in Florida
  • Conducted outreach to media in support of evolution and in opposition to the intelligent design movement currently active in Florida.

        Main Goal: Improve Scientific Literacy in the general population.

         Review of Environment:

    Scientific Literacy is an essential skill to have in this modern age.  Science and technology are     integral to every aspect of modern life: from what we eat and where we live to how we work.  Knowledge of science determines how effectively we as a society adapt to technological changes, how we will deal with problems such as disease, the environment and even war.  Good citizenship now requires a basic level of scientific literacy.  The price we will pay as a society for not promoting and encouraging scientific literacy could ultimately be our survival as a species. 

        HFA’s strategy to improve scientific literacy focuses on three main areas:

  • Science Education
  • Science Policy
  • Scientific Ethics

Education

  • Founded the Carl Sagan Academy in Tampa

    Goal: HFA wants to popularize science and its peaceful applications and to encourage individual growth aimed toward achieving a more progressive, enlightened and sane society.

    Background: Humanists are profoundly committed to the belief that all people can, and do, learn and are dedicated to sustaining and strengthening public education in pursuit of a more enlightened and compassionate society.  

    HFA’s main Education focus and Goals

  • The Carl Sagan Academies
  • Pre-K Education
  • Play Group Support
  • Private K-12 Schools

Community

  • Helped certify 3 new celebrants in Florida
  • Founded the Humanist Family Network of Florida
  • Provided support and training for over 30 humanist groups around the state.

    Goal: HFA will work to create an environment where people may actively and openly practice their humanist life stance, by providing support and services to Humanist communities that embodies the key Humanist principles of “Reason and Compassion in Action.”

    Successful integration of our philosophies into society requires the creation of communities with common goals and interests.

    Communities Focus Areas:

  • Local group support – create and support Humanist communities – one community at a time.
  • Celebrants – promote, train, support, etc.
  • Projects  - how can local groups support the work of HFA.
